About the Medical Policy Coordinator Intern:

Medical Policy Coordinator Intern will support the Scientific Affairs team in researching, developing, and reviewing medical policies. This internship is designed for a current undergraduate or graduate student pursuing a degree in a healthcare-related field such as Public Health, Health Policy, Biology, Nursing, Pre-Med, or a related discipline.   

This is a part-time summer internship opportunity that is eligible for remote work, but travel to the corporate office in Tampa, FL may be requested during the assignment.

Medical Policy Coordinator Intern - Essential Functions and Responsibilities:

  • Complete conversion of Laboratory Policies initial draft of Translation Guide, as assigned by Scientific Affairs Manager Implementation Consultant 
  • Conduct policy research to support maintenance of science intent in Translation Guide library 
  • Thoughtfully map rationale to bridge between Laboratory Policies and Translation Guide 
  • Actively participate in work teams to ensure overall deliverables meet the needs of both client and internal processes 

Medical Policy Coordinator Intern - Minimum Qualifications:

  • Current grad student, with focused studies in one of the following: healthcare administration, public health, political science or public administration, public policy.
  • Strong analytical abilities to interpret complex information.
  • Excellent communication skills and writing abilities.

Medical Policy Coordinator Intern - Preferred Qualifications:

  • Prior experience in a healthcare setting with exposure to billing, advocacy, laboratory science, or claims processing
  • Prior experience in policy research and a developed skillset in policy writing and translation
